We take a team-based approach to treating Parkinson’s disease by managing your symptoms and slowing the disease’s progression. Your team will include fellowship-trained neurologists who specialize in Parkinson’s disease. Depending on your symptoms, you may also work with specially trained neurosurgeons, physical therapists, speech therapists, social service advocates and movement disorder nurses.

More About Parkinson’s Disease

Parkinson’s disease is a brain disorder that affects motor skills such as balance and coordination. It can cause shaking and stiffness, eventually making walking and using the arms and hands difficult. Parkinson’s is a degenerative disease, which means it worsens over time.
